The Heart of the Matter

In a world filled with distractions, maintaining purity of heart can be challenging. When Jesus spoke of the "pure in heart," He wasn’t referencing mere outward appearance or ritual cleanliness. He spoke of an inner alignment—an undivided heart focused on God. Imagine how different life could be if our every thought, desire, and intention were wholeheartedly devoted to Him.

Purity of heart is about sincerity and authenticity. It means having motives that align with God’s own heart, steering clear of deceit or hypocrisy. King David, aware of life’s moral complexities, pleaded in Psalm 51:10, "Create in me a pure heart, O God, and renew a steadfast spirit within me."

Steps Toward Seeing God More Clearly

To see God, we must cultivate purity in our lives. Here are some ways to begin this transformative journey:

  1. Self-Reflection and Prayer: Regularly examine your heart and ask God to reveal any impurities. Simple prayers for guidance can be powerful.

  2. Scripture Immersion: Dive into God’s Word, allowing it to cleanse and guide. Verses such as Philippians 4:8 encourage us to focus on what is true, noble, and pure.

  3. Embrace Grace and Forgiveness: Remember that purity isn’t achieved through our efforts alone. Embrace the grace offered through Jesus’ sacrifice, allowing it to wash over and renew your heart.

  4. Surround with Community: Engage with believers who encourage and support a pure walk with God. Share struggles and successes to grow together in faith.

The Unmatched Vision of God

The promise of seeing God isn’t just for the afterlife. When our hearts are pure, we begin to see Him in everyday moments—in the warmth of a loving community, the beauty of creation, and the quiet assurance in prayer. This clarity offers unshakeable peace, founded on the deep and abiding presence of God in our lives.

A pure heart isn’t about perfection but about progress toward becoming more like Christ. Moment by moment, our pursuit draws us closer to God and expands our capacity to perceive His hand in our daily lives.
